如果需要保留提交历史,你可能需要考虑使用 git cherry-pick 命令来选择性地将分支 A 中的特定提交合并到当前分支 3.git cherry-pick选择性合并文件 git cherry-pick 命令用于选择性地将一个或多个提交从一个分支应用到另一个分支上。这个命令可以用于合并单个提交或一系列提交,而不需要将整个分支合并过来。 3.1.gi...
在Git中,要将当前分支合并到当前分支,需要使用Git的合并命令。 下面是合并当前分支到当前分支的步骤: 1. 首先,确保你当前所在的分支是需要合并的目标分支。如果不是,可以使用命令`git checkout <目标分支>`切换到目标分支。例如,如果你想合并到`main`分支,可以使用命令`git checkout main`。 2. 接下来,通过使用...
1. 首先,确保你的当前分支是目标分支(即你希望合并其他分支到的分支)。你可以使用命令”git branch”查看当前所在分支,并使用命令”git checkout”切换到目标分支。 例如,要切换到名为”main”的分支,可以运行以下命令: “` git checkout main “` 2. 接下来,运行”git merge”命令来合并其他分支到当前分支。...
当你切换分支的时候,Git 会用该分支的最后提交的快照替换你的工作目录的内容, 所以多个分支不需要多个目录。 查看分支 查看所有分支: git branch 查看远程分支: git branch-r 查看所有本地和远程分支: git branch-a 合并分支 将其他分支合并到当前分支: git merge<branchname> 例如,切换到 main 分支并合并 featu...
1.将当前分支修改数据commit git commit -m "this is local branch commit" 2.将分支切换到主分支 git checkout master 3.拉取主分支的最新代码 git pull origin master 4.合并分支代码到主分支(合并主分支最新代码到本地分支) //(合并本地分支到主分支) git merge dev //合并主分支到本地分支 git check...
1. 切换到主干分支 git checkout main 2. 拉取主干分支最新代码 git pull origin main 3. 切换回自己分支 git chekcout <your-branch-name> 4. 合并主干分支内容 git merge main 5. 解决冲突并提交 # 解决冲突 git commit -m "Merge main into <your-branch-name>" ...
git commit -m '合并分支代码到主分支' image.png 5. 推送代码到主分支 git push origin master image.png 6. 如果想回到分支继续开发,就切换回去,然后查看当前分支检查是否切换成功即可。 git checkout take_photo git branch image.png 总结 我们总共用到了git中的如下几个命令 ...
步骤四:合并目标分支 git merge origin/master (步骤五:还原暂存的内容) git stash pop stash@{0} (步骤六:解决冲突) 可能会遇到因为冲突切换分支失败或者合并失败的情况,此时需要查看具体冲突并且进行修改 以下是具体的解决冲突的操作(图片引用自https://blog.csdn.net/weixin_36099799/article/details/113010025)...
所以Git只是简单地将当前分支的指针向前移动到 "dev" ' 分支的最新提交上,而没有创建一个新的合并...